Letter #4
To: M. Berniche
From: Lafayette
Date: February 23, 1824
In French

Paris 23 February 1824
I am much happier in my friendships than in my correspondences, my dear Constituent. My answer to our friend Mr. Bejor was addressed where he was not. Your letter came to me late. It is only today as I am leaving for La Grange that I can address to you my sincere thanks. I am already the Constituent for all the liberals from the Maux division of the department which to me is very honorable and enjoyable. If you have successful results I hope to deserve your continuing trust. (Illegible)
With all my very best
Lafayette
